BitpackEncoder(unsigned bytestreamNumber, SourceDestBuffer &sbuf, unsigned outputMaxSize, unsigned alignmentSize) | e57::BitpackEncoder | protected |
BitpackIntegerEncoder(bool isScaledInteger, unsigned bytestreamNumber, SourceDestBuffer &sbuf, unsigned outputMaxSize, int64_t minimum, int64_t maximum, double scale, double offset) | e57::BitpackIntegerEncoder< RegisterT > | |
bitsPerRecord() override | e57::BitpackIntegerEncoder< RegisterT > | virtual |
bitsPerRecord_ | e57::BitpackIntegerEncoder< RegisterT > | protected |
bytestreamNumber() const | e57::Encoder | |
bytestreamNumber_ | e57::Encoder | protected |
currentRecordIndex() override | e57::BitpackEncoder | virtual |
currentRecordIndex_ | e57::BitpackEncoder | protected |
Encoder(unsigned bytestreamNumber) | e57::Encoder | protected |
EncoderFactory(unsigned bytestreamNumber, std::shared_ptr< CompressedVectorNodeImpl > cVector, std::vector< SourceDestBuffer > &sbuf, ustring &codecPath) | e57::Encoder | static |
isScaledInteger_ | e57::BitpackIntegerEncoder< RegisterT > | protected |
maximum_ | e57::BitpackIntegerEncoder< RegisterT > | protected |
minimum_ | e57::BitpackIntegerEncoder< RegisterT > | protected |
offset_ | e57::BitpackIntegerEncoder< RegisterT > | protected |
outBuffer_ | e57::BitpackEncoder | protected |
outBufferAlignmentSize_ | e57::BitpackEncoder | protected |
outBufferEnd_ | e57::BitpackEncoder | protected |
outBufferFirst_ | e57::BitpackEncoder | protected |
outBufferShiftDown() | e57::BitpackEncoder | protected |
outputAvailable() const override | e57::BitpackEncoder | virtual |
outputClear() override | e57::BitpackEncoder | virtual |
outputGetMaxSize() override | e57::BitpackEncoder | virtual |
outputRead(char *dest, const size_t byteCount) override | e57::BitpackEncoder | virtual |
outputSetMaxSize(unsigned byteCount) override | e57::BitpackEncoder | virtual |
processRecords(size_t recordCount) override | e57::BitpackIntegerEncoder< RegisterT > | virtual |
register_ | e57::BitpackIntegerEncoder< RegisterT > | protected |
registerBitsUsed_ | e57::BitpackIntegerEncoder< RegisterT > | protected |
registerFlushToOutput() override | e57::BitpackIntegerEncoder< RegisterT > | virtual |
scale_ | e57::BitpackIntegerEncoder< RegisterT > | protected |
sourceBitMask_ | e57::BitpackIntegerEncoder< RegisterT > | protected |
sourceBuffer_ | e57::BitpackEncoder | protected |
sourceBufferNextIndex() override | e57::BitpackEncoder | virtual |
sourceBufferSetNew(std::vector< SourceDestBuffer > &sbufs) override | e57::BitpackEncoder | virtual |
~Encoder()=default | e57::Encoder | virtual |